Senior Rust Backend Engineer for High-Performance Trading in London

Senior Rust Backend Engineer for High-Performance Trading in London

London Full-Time 70000 - 90000 £ / year (est.) No working from home possible
Blockchain Ventures

At a Glance

  • Tasks: Build low latency, scalable trading services and enhance OMS functionality.
  • Company: Blockchain Ventures, a leader in innovative trading technology.
  • Benefits: Competitive pay, professional development budgets, unlimited vacation, and flexible work culture.
  • Other info: Exciting opportunities for growth in a fast-paced environment.
  • Why this job: Join a dynamic team and make an impact in high-performance trading.
  • Qualifications: Extensive experience in C++ and/or Rust, with knowledge of trading systems architecture.

The predicted salary is between 70000 - 90000 £ per year.

Blockchain Ventures is seeking a Senior Software Engineer for their London office. In this role, you will build low latency, scalable trading services and enhance OMS functionality in a dynamic environment.

Ideal candidates will have extensive experience in C++ and/or Rust, as well as familiarity with trading systems architecture.

The position offers competitive compensation, professional development budgets, unlimited vacation, and a flexible work culture.

Senior Rust Backend Engineer for High-Performance Trading in London employer: Blockchain Ventures

Blockchain Ventures is an exceptional employer, offering a vibrant work culture in the heart of London where innovation thrives. With competitive compensation, unlimited vacation, and a strong emphasis on professional development, employees are empowered to grow their skills while contributing to cutting-edge trading solutions. The dynamic environment fosters collaboration and creativity, making it an ideal place for those seeking meaningful and rewarding employment in the tech industry.

Blockchain Ventures

Contact Details:

Blockchain Ventures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Senior Rust Backend Engineer for High-Performance Trading in London

Tip Number 1

Network like a pro! Reach out to folks in the trading and tech space on LinkedIn or at meetups. You never know who might have the inside scoop on job openings or can put in a good word for you.

Tip Number 2

Show off your skills! If you've got a GitHub or personal project showcasing your Rust or C++ prowess, make sure to highlight it. It’s a great way to demonstrate your expertise beyond just words.

Tip Number 3

Prepare for technical interviews by brushing up on low latency systems and trading architecture. Practice coding challenges that focus on performance and scalability – these are key in the trading world!

Tip Number 4

Don’t forget to apply through our website! We’ve got loads of opportunities waiting for talented engineers like you. Plus, it’s a straightforward way to get your application noticed.

We think you need these skills to ace Senior Rust Backend Engineer for High-Performance Trading in London

Rust
C++
Low Latency Development
Scalable Trading Services
OMS Functionality Enhancement
Trading Systems Architecture
Dynamic Environment Adaptability

Some tips for your application 🫡

Show Off Your Skills:Make sure to highlight your experience with Rust and C++ in your application. We want to see how you've used these languages in real-world projects, especially in trading systems or similar environments.

Tailor Your Application:Don’t just send a generic CV! Customise your application to reflect the specific requirements of the Senior Software Engineer role. Mention any relevant projects or experiences that align with building low latency, scalable trading services.

Be Clear and Concise:When writing your cover letter, keep it straightforward. We appreciate clarity, so get to the point about why you’re a great fit for the role and what you can bring to our team at Blockchain Ventures.

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you don’t miss out on any important updates during the process!

How to prepare for a job interview at Blockchain Ventures

Know Your Rust Inside Out

Make sure you brush up on your Rust skills before the interview. Be prepared to discuss your experience with low latency systems and how you've implemented performance optimisations in past projects. Having specific examples ready will show your depth of knowledge.

Understand Trading Systems Architecture

Familiarise yourself with trading systems architecture, especially if you have experience in C++. Be ready to explain how different components interact in a trading environment and how you’ve contributed to enhancing functionality in previous roles.

Showcase Problem-Solving Skills

Expect technical questions that assess your problem-solving abilities. Practice coding challenges related to backend development and be prepared to walk through your thought process. This will demonstrate your analytical skills and ability to work under pressure.

Emphasise Team Collaboration

Since this role involves working in a dynamic environment, highlight your experience collaborating with cross-functional teams. Share examples of how you’ve successfully communicated complex technical concepts to non-technical stakeholders, as this is crucial in a trading context.